How much does a computer network support specialists make in North Dakota?

The median computer network support specialists salary in North Dakota is $70,740 per year ($34.01/hr). This is 4% below the national median of $73,340. Salaries range from $52,490 to $93,460.

Can a computer network support specialists afford to live in North Dakota?

At the median salary of $70,740, a computer network support specialists in North Dakota would take home approximately $4,731/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 29.8% of take-home pay going to housing. This is within the recommended 30% guideline.

What are the best cities for computer network support specialists in North Dakota?

The highest paying metro areas for computer network support specialists in North Dakota are Bismarck ($72,270), Minot ($72,010), Fargo ($70,200). However, cost of living varies significantly between metros — a higher salary may not mean more purchasing power.
